Understanding the Dynamics of Risk and Reward

At the heart of this heightened gameplay is a fundamental shift in risk assessment. Traditional Monopoly players might prioritize safe, consistent gains. The “big baller” approach, however, embraces calculated risks, recognizing that substantial rewards often require substantial investments. This means aggressively pursuing desirable properties, even if it stretches your financial resources, and being willing to leverage debt to expand your portfolio. It's not simply about avoiding bankruptcy; it's about strategically positioning yourself to capitalize on opportunities as they arise, even if it means flirting with financial ruin. The faster pace encourages bolder moves, and the potential for rapid gains—or losses—is significantly increased. Mastering this balance between prudence and audacity is crucial.

The Power of Early Investment

Early game investment is paramount. Securing key properties – those with high rent potential and strategic locations – sets the foundation for future success. Don’t hesitate to mortgage less valuable assets to finance the acquisition of prime real estate. Ignoring the opportunity to secure a monopoly early on can prove disastrous, leaving you at the mercy of opponents who have already established a dominant presence on the board. The aim isn't incremental growth, but swift domination. The ability to quickly evaluate property value and predict opponent behavior is a key differentiator between a casual player and a serious contender. Understanding the likely hood of landing on certain squares, based on dice probabilities, is also a crucial skill.

The Art of Negotiation and Trading

While the dice play a role, a significant portion of success depends on your ability to negotiate and trade effectively. The "monopoly big baller" isn’t afraid to propose unconventional deals, leveraging their assets to acquire properties they desperately need. This is more than just swapping properties; it’s about understanding the long-term implications of each trade and anticipating your opponent’s needs. A seemingly unfavorable trade can be advantageous if it completes a monopoly or denies your opponent a critical piece of the board. Recognizing how to exploit these situations is a mark of a skilled player. Building rapport and establishing trust can also be beneficial, but never at the expense of your own strategic goals. Remember, the ultimate objective is to bankrupt your rivals.

Mastering the Offer and Counter-Offer

The art of negotiation hinges on the ability to make compelling offers and skillfully counter opposing proposals. Researching your opponent’s properties and understanding their strategic priorities is crucial. A well-timed offer, tailored to their specific needs, is more likely to be accepted. Similarly, be prepared to justify your own demands and defend the value of your assets. Don't be afraid to walk away from a bad deal; sometimes, the best negotiation tactic is patience. Be prepared to bundle properties, offer cash incentives, or even promise future considerations to sweeten the pot. The aim is to create a win-win scenario, but always ensuring you come out ahead.

  • Always assess the true value of a property, not just its face value.
  • Understand your opponent's priorities and leverage their weaknesses.
  • Be prepared to walk away from a bad deal.
  • Don’t reveal your hand – maintain a poker face.

Successful negotiation isn’t about being aggressive; it’s about being strategic and insightful. A genuine willingness to consider your opponent’s perspective will ultimately yield more favorable outcomes.

Strategic House and Hotel Development

Once you've secured monopolies, the next phase is aggressive development. Building houses and hotels isn’t simply about increasing rent; it’s about creating a significant barrier to entry for your opponents. The higher the rent, the faster they’ll be forced to liquidate their assets, bringing them closer to bankruptcy. When developing properties, focus on maximizing the return on investment. Prioritize properties with the highest potential for generating revenue and strategically distribute your houses and hotels to create a formidable economic stronghold. Don't overextend yourself, but don’t hesitate to invest heavily in properties that are likely to see frequent traffic. The ability to quickly transform a property into a revenue-generating machine is a hallmark of a skilled player.

Optimizing Development Timing

The timing of your development is critical. Building houses too early can leave you vulnerable to cash flow problems, while waiting too long allows your opponents to gain a competitive advantage. Consider the current state of the game, the financial resources of your opponents, and the likelihood of landing on your properties when deciding when to develop. A well-timed development push can cripple your opponents and accelerate their downfall. The goal is to create a situation where they are forced to make difficult choices – whether to mortgage properties, sell assets, or risk bankruptcy. Understanding these dynamics is essential for maximizing your profitability.

  1. Secure monopolies as quickly as possible.
  2. Prioritize development on high-traffic properties.
  3. Monitor your opponents’ cash flow.
  4. Time your development to maximize impact.

Strategic development is an iterative process. Continuously evaluate the effectiveness of your investments and adjust your strategy as the game evolves.
